The club had some huge issues with back ended contracts. It's all well and good to say 'Fulton was on $400k' etc however the contracts aren't even. To get it under the salary cap for a 3 year contract they might do $150k for 2013, $200k for 2014 and then $600k for 2015\. This is how clubs get themselves into trouble.

That's one great thing about Mayer, he refused to offer these huge back ended deals that have tied us up in the past. For players like Teddy we had a max value we could offer in the cap, and while there may be small increases per season (which is normal) he wouldn't just throw an extra 200k to teddy's last year to ensure he stays.

The other thing you have to remember in terms of salaries is that players will often take pay cuts in order to keep a strong team together in order to win a premiership. You see players at Manly who've done this recently for example.

Clubs who are at the bottom of the league often have to pay more for players to act an an incentive for them to play there rather than at a better club.

You might find some off contract players at Souths or the Roosters who may be able to get $300-350k on the open market, but in order to win another comp and stay loyal with their mates they may take $200-250k and stay.

Obviously different players have different priorities, winning, gametime, setting up their family etc, but we would be overpaying many of our players to stop them being enticed to leave the club.
